The 23:00 reality on Hvar villas
This is the part most clients don’t ask about and then get caught by.
Croatian national law: quiet hours 23:00–07:00. Most Hvar villa rental contracts reference this explicitly, and many add their own clauses — “no amplified music after 22:30” or “no outdoor music after 23:00.”
Hvar Town, Stari Grad and Jelsa are residential at the points where the villas sit. Your neighbors are full-time residents or other holidaymakers, not the Zrće beach. A noise complaint to the local communal police gets resolved fast and the villa owner will keep your damage deposit.
What this means for your party plan:
- Build the night to peak at 21:00–22:30, not midnight.
- Move indoors at 22:45. The Bose S1 Pro+ stereo pair sounds excellent inside a stone villa with the doors closed.
- If you want the party to genuinely run until 2am, go to a club in Hvar Town. Carpe Diem, Kiva, Pink Champagne. Don’t fight the noise law at your villa.
- A wireless mic + lights for the dinner speech at 20:00 hits harder than trying to push music until 1am anyway.
We’ve done a hundred Hvar villa parties. The clients who plan for the 23:00 cut-off have a brilliant night. The clients who think they can ignore it lose a deposit.
